Women's Basketball Has Second Half Meltdown Friday Night in the Torodome
Gators outscore the Toros 30-16 in the second half to roll to 61-51 victory
January 17, 2003

CARSON, Calif.- Dr. Jekyll and Ms. Hyde made an appearance in the Torodome tonight, as the Toros suffered a 61-51 CCAA setback to the visiting Gators of San Francisco State. The loss drops the Toros to 5-6 overall and 3-4 in the CCAA, while the Gators improve to 7-5 overall and 3-4 in conference action with the win on the road.

Things started off right for CSUDH, as they went on a 7-0 run to begin the game. In fact, the Toros led by as much as ten after junior guard Monique Marquez (Rialto, CA/Eisenhower HS) nailed one from deep to put the Toros on top 33-23.

Although CSUDH wasn't shooting well in the first half, only 33%, defense was their story. They were able to force 20 Gator turnovers. Marquez took the ball away four times, with eight of ten Toros posting at least one steal or more. Freshman guard Teresa Cooper (Simi Valley, CA/Simi Valley HS) continued her dominance from beyond the arc. Cooper, who is leading the Toros in three point shooting on the season, connected on 3 of 6 attempts. She had a team-leading 11 points in the first half for CSUDH, as the Toros were holding onto a 35-31 lead as the teams took to the locker rooms for the half.

Then, Ms. Hyde made her debut.

It took until the 9:30 mark for the Toros to get their first field goal. SFSU went on a 12-1 run, before DeLaney Turner (Fremont, CA/Santa Barbara CC) was able to drive the baseline and convert on the play. After the first 15 minutes of play in the second half, CSUDH scored only five points. Their low 33% first-half field goal percentage dropped to an even lower 23%.

The Gators took the lead at the 12:34 mark and kept it to the final buzzer, leading by as much as 13 with 0:46 remaining on the clock.

The Gators outscored the Toros 30-16 in the second half.

Jennifer Kutz dominated the boards for SFSU. After pulling down seven in the first half, the senior center went hard to the glass to finish off the night with 13 rebounds. She was also the top scorer in the contest, with 18 points.

SFSU was consistent, converting on 50% of their attempts, compared to the Toros who shot a season-low 29% from the floor.

Cooper led the Toros in scoring on the night with 14, 11 of those coming in the first half. Tameka Blue (Watsonville, CA/Santa Cruz HS) made it into double-figure scoring pouring in ten points.

CSUDH did get a strong appearance on the glass tonight by senior Nakeisha Perkins. (Tarzana, CA/Grant HS) Perkins pulled down 13 boards in CSUDH's effort.

The Toros will look to rebound tomorrow night when they take on the Seawolves of Sonoma State University. First tip is slated for 5:30 p.m.
